#28ac1d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#28ac1d is composed of 15.7% red, 67.5%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.1%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 115.4 degrees, a saturation of 71.1% and a lightness of 39.4%. #28ac1d color hex could be obtained by blending #50ff3a with #005900.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#28ac1d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010401 is the darkest color, while #f3fdf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#28ac1d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#636663 is the less saturated color, while #14c306 is the most saturated one.
